https://bugs.kde.org/show_bug.cgi?id=452171

            Bug ID: 452171
           Summary: [Wayland] Application property "Virtual desktops"
                    doesn't work properly
           Product: plasmashell
           Version: 5.24.4
          Platform: Archlinux Packages
                OS: Linux
            Status: REPORTED
          Severity: normal
          Priority: NOR
         Component: general
          Assignee: plasma-b...@kde.org
          Reporter: cancel.sizable...@mailly.org
                CC: k...@davidedmundson.co.uk
  Target Milestone: 1.0

SUMMARY
Under Wayland session, with several virtual desktops, if you change the
"Virtual desktops" property for an application and open this application in a
different virtual desktop, the application will appear on several virtual
desktop pager and task manager.

STEPS TO REPRODUCE
1. Run plasma under Wayland
2. Create 2 virtual desktops (I'll name them Desktop A and Desktop B but we
don't care this is not important)
3. Run an application, e.g. Konsole
4. Right click on the title menu -> More actions -> Configure Special
Applications Settings
5. Add property "Virtual Desktop"
6. Set "Apply initially" (works with "Force" too)
7. Set "Desktop B" and apply
8. Right click on the "Task Manager" -> Configure Task Manager...
9. Behavior -> Check "Show only tasks from current desktop"
10. Go on Desktop A
11. Open Konsole

OBSERVED RESULT
Now you should see that the Konsole has opened on Desktop B, but it still
appears in the Desktop A's Task Manager, and you can also see the Konsole's
window in the pager for Desktop A and B.

EXPECTED RESULT
The application should only appear on the assigned virtual desktop task
manager, and only on the right virtual desktop pager.
NB: It works correctly with Xorg.

SOFTWARE/OS VERSIONS
Linux/KDE Plasma: 5.17.1
(available in About System)
KDE Plasma Version: 5.24.4
KDE Frameworks Version: 5.92.0
Qt Version: 5.15.3

ADDITIONAL INFORMATION

-- 
You are receiving this mail because:
You are watching all bug changes.

Reply via email to